1. Roasted Red Potatoes

I love something crispy and warm to balance out a creamy casserole, and these roasted red potatoes do just that.

They have a nice crunch from the outside, but they’re still soft and fluffy on the inside.

Plus, they’re super easy to make – you just need some olive oil, salt, and pepper.

Pro Tip: Cut your potatoes into even pieces so that they cook evenly.

3 Unique Twists:

  • Add garlic for extra flavor
  • Use sweet potatoes instead of red potatoes
  • Mix in some chopped up bacon or sausage

10. Spinach Salad with Hot Bacon Dressing

Bacon dressing and spinach?

I know, it sounds like an odd combination.

But trust me, it works.

The salty, smoky bacon pairs perfectly with the earthy spinach leaves.

Plus, the hot dressing wilts the spinach slightly, making it even more delicious.

Pro Tip: If you can’t find hot bacon dressing at your local grocery store, you can easily make your own by cooking bacon and adding red pepper flakes to the grease.

3 Unique Twists:

  • Add crumbled blue cheese to the salad for a tangy flavor contrast.
  • Swap out the spinach for kale or arugula for a slightly different flavor profile.
  • Top with roasted almonds or pecans for a bit of crunch.
